CATEGORY | QUANTITY | RANK |
A | 10 | 1 |
A | 10 | 2 |
B | 20 | 1 |
C | 30 | 1 |
C | 40 | 2 |
I have a table similar to this and I have listed the desired rank column. I need a calculated column to rank based on the dates eventhough it has duplicates.
Need sequence for each duplicate values.
Looking forward to your help.
Solved! Go to Solution.
Hi @Anonymous ,
Here are the steps you can follow:
1. Create calculated column.
rand = RAND()
rank =
RANKX(FILTER(ALL('Table'),'Table'[Category]=EARLIER('Table'[Category])),'Table'[Quantity]+'Table'[rand],,ASC,Dense)
2. Result:
